Herbert L. Byrd

68 years old

Herbert Lee Byrd, 68 years old, lives in Bronx, NY. Herbert has also lived in New York, NY. Some of Herbert family members are Mikicia O Byrd and Mildred O Taylor.

Public Records

Arrest Records

Scroll